WINDWARD PLANNING COMMISSION <br /> COUNTY OF HAWAII <br /> ACTIONS <br /> December 3, 2020 <br /> 1. APPLICANT: MOANIALA HOLDINGS, LLC (AMEND REZ 738) <br /> Application to delete Condition E of Ordinance No. 15 50, which required the applicant <br /> to secure and dedicate land area for the future extension of Kukuau Street from the <br /> Sunrise Estates Subdivision to the Puainako Street Extension. Ordinance No. 15 50 <br /> amended Ordinance No. 08 115, which amended Ordinance No. 93 36, which rezoned <br /> lands from Agricultural-20 acres (A-20a), Agricultural-10 acres (A-10a), and <br /> Agricultural-3 acres (A-3a) to a Residential and Agricultural-1 acre (RA-la) zoning <br /> district. The subject property is located south of the Puainako Street Extension, west of <br /> Komohana Street at Hilo Hillside Estates Subdivision at Kukuau 1st, South Hilo, Hawaii, <br /> TMK: 2-4-082:001-056, 058-061 (formerly 2-4-008: portions of 014 and 026). <br /> APPLICANT HAS WITHDREW APPLICATION <br /> 2. INITIATOR: PLANNING DIRECTOR <br /> An ordinance amending Chapter 25 (Zoning Code), Article 1, Article 2, Article 4, Article <br /> 5 and Article 7 of the Hawaii County Code 1983 (2016 Edition, as amended), relating to <br /> definitions, use permit requirements, off-street parking requirements, and zoning district <br /> regulations for medical clinics and massage, acupuncture, chiropractic and other similar <br /> health service facilities. <br /> FA VORABLE RECOMMENDATION TO THE CO LINTY CO UNCIL <br /> Minutes of November 5, 2020 meeting: APPROVED <br />
